With its show-stoppingly slick design and tranquil gardens, the hotel feels a world away from the sensory whirlwind outside — in fact, it was recently crowned the best stay globally by World’s 50 Best Hotels.

There’s also complimentary drinks and canapés every afternoon in the residents-only Living Room, herbal-infused afternoon teas served in the Tea Lounge, and after-dinner tipples at Stella, the hotel’s boudoir-like bar, presided over by a taxidermied peacock, no less — where you can slurp down artfully concocted cocktails with a side of wagyu beef sandos.

I’ve had more personalised, show-stopping experiences (mainly of the culinary and wellness variety) at some of the other contenders on the World’s 50 Best list, but when it comes to city stays, Capella Bangkok is undoubtedly a knockout.

I stayed in a Riverfront Premier Room — despite being one of the hotel’s entry-level bedrooms, it easily topped some city suites I’ve stayed in elsewhere.

The hotel sits within a closeted curve of historic Charoenkrung Road, placing you within easy reach of Bangkok’s most famous night markets and temple complexes.
